diff options
Diffstat (limited to 'lib/api/entities/deploy_key.rb')
-rw-r--r-- | lib/api/entities/deploy_key.rb |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/lib/api/entities/deploy_key.rb b/lib/api/entities/deploy_key.rb index e8537c4c677..2c9c33549a1 100644 --- a/lib/api/entities/deploy_key.rb +++ b/lib/api/entities/deploy_key.rb @@ -4,7 +4,8 @@ module API module Entities class DeployKey < Entities::SSHKey expose :key - expose :fingerprint + expose :fingerprint, if: ->(key, _) { key.fingerprint.present? } + expose :fingerprint_sha256 expose :projects_with_write_access, using: Entities::ProjectIdentity, if: -> (_, options) { options[:include_projects_with_write_access] } end |